  • Carrie

Carrie is a movie based on Stephen King's novel with the same title. It tells a story of a girl named Carrie who faces the bullying from her classmates at school and abuse from her fanatically pious mother at home, then she also discovers that she has telekinesis power. When she thinks everything is starting to get better because the most famous guy in school asks he to prom, it's actually that start of her doom.

  • The Others 

The Others is a movie about In 1945, in Jersey, Channel Islands, the widow Grace Stewart lives in a lonely old house with her daughter Anne and her son Nicholas. Grace lost her beloved husband Charles in the World War II and their children are photosensitive and Grace keeps the curtains and the doors closed to protect Anne and Nicholas against the sunlight. Grace raises her children with strict discipline and following religious principles. Grace hires the strange housekeeper Mrs. Bertha Mills, the mute maid Lydia and the gardener Mr. Edmund Tuttle that have asked for a job. Out of the blue, mysterious things happen in the mansion and Anne claims that there is a boy named Viktor that visits them. Grace unsuccessfully seeks out the intruders until the day she has a revelation about the house and its intruders.

  • Insidious 1&2


This movie tells the story of a family and their problems with their new haunted house and their son that's in a coma like state after he fell from the ladder. When the parents checked into the hospital, it was shown that everything was normal physically. And turns out, it wasn't physical at all. They discovered that the son inherited an ability to do astral projection from his father and the son was trapped in another dimension called "Further" that contained all the lost spirits. His father was clueless about this ability because it was wiped out from his mind. So the psychic who was also the one that took care of his father "ability" back when he was younger, encouraged him to do the astral projection in order to bring the son back. Well, the spirit of the son came back, but the father's spirit wasn't. A spirit who always wanted to have his body all along his life finally got what he wanted and killed the psychic too. 

The second movie was a little less scary and we dove into the life of the spirit that now was in the father's body. Like how he was treated as a girl by his mother, and so on and so on.
